open innovation

Progressive companies are increasingly using external resources, such as consumers or even external experts, in their search for innovations. In this context, we speak of open innovation.

Such open innovation lays the foundation for systematic use of all available sources and maximizes a company's innovation potential.

One example of the application of open innovation is the co-creation approach, in which consumers can contribute their own ideas to product development. Another example is open source as the most far-reaching variant of open innovation. Henry Chesbrough, Professor at the Haas School of Business, UC Berkeley, is considered the founder of the Open Innovation concept.
